Fort Worth, Texas City Manager Sam Bothwell and Miss Lelia Feregar. Miss Feregar received from the state Department of Health Grade C licenses, the reward of special school duty and completion of written examination. Miss Feregar's license is believed to be the first ever issued in Texas to a woman. Published in Fort Worth Star-Telegram, evening edition, September 14, 1944.
